Robotics

Robotics is a branch of engineering and technology that involves the design, construction, operation, and use of robots. It combines elements from mechanical engineering, electrical engineering, computer science, and artificial intelligence to create machines capable of performing tasks autonomously or semi-autonomously. Robotics encompasses the development of both the hardware (the physical robot itself) and the software (the programming that controls the robot). Robots are utilized in various applications, including manufacturing, healthcare, space exploration, military operations, and everyday tasks, enhancing efficiency, precision, and safety in numerous fields.
